Understanding Hand Injuries

Types of Hand Injuries

  • Fractures: Broken bones in the hand can occur from impact injuries or accidents.
  • Sprains and strains: Overstretching or tearing of ligaments or tendons in the hand.
  • Tendon injuries: Damage to the tendons that control movement in the hand.
  • Nerve damage: Injuries to the nerves in the hand can cause numbness, tingling, or loss of sensation.

Symptoms of Hand Injuries

  • Pain
  • Swelling
  • Bruising
  • Stiffness
  • Weakness
  • Loss of motion

Preventing Hand Injuries

While accidents can happen, there are steps you can take to prevent hand injuries and protect your hands:

Use Proper Protective Gear

  • Wear gloves when working with tools or machinery.
  • Use wrist guards for sports activities that involve impact or falls.

Practice Safe Techniques

  • Learn the correct form and techniques for activities that involve repetitive hand movements.
  • Take breaks and rest your hands during prolonged tasks.

Maintain Hand Health

  • Stay hydrated to keep your tendons and joints lubricated.
  • Stretch your hands and fingers regularly to improve flexibility.
  • Avoid excessive gripping or gripping too tightly.
